I may certainly not hang around to read them.Regression through Cullen Bunn, Marie Enger, as well as Danny Luckert.It had to do with 7 years back-- still early on in my comics obsession-- when I found this particular problem deferred of my LCS. I really did not require to understand anything concerning the property. That horrifying, many-legged creature creeping on the protagonist's ear sufficed for me to know I needed to have it. And in fact, this was actually the first terror comic series to wind up on my pull listing. In Regression, a guy experiences waking nightmares that normally include him dealt with in creepy crawlies. When he accepts to engage in some past-life regression hypnosis, he is actually taken into an occult conspiracy theory he didn't observe happening.
Babble by Rachel Harrison.Okay. So the arachnids in this lighthearted scary don't take center stage, yet they carry out function as familiars. Guide centers all around Annie, that has moved to a small community in an effort to begin again, merely to come to be besties with a female that becomes a witch. But prior to she notices her close friend's accurate identification, a small crawler appears in her apartment, one she eventually needs to carrying all around in her wallet like an animal. It appears the spider really belongs to her brand-new pal, as well as it's one of a lot of who assist around your house. Can Annie take this done in stride, or even will she run screaming back to her aged lifestyle?
Ordinary Bad Idols by Emily M. Danforth.Over a century ago, pair of young women-- pupils at the Brookhants School for Girls-- are actually eliminated through a swarm of yellowjackets. My headache, primarily. The organization is actually later pointed out to be plagued and is actually ultimately stopped. Rapid onward to the present day, as well as a manual concerning the school's queer, feminist (and haunted) past is being conformed for film. When the author of the book and the film's 2 stars get to the site of the previous university to start recording, it seems to be menstruation that stated the lives of those trainees all those years ago has rekindled.
The Key Lifestyle of Pests and Other Stories through Bernardo Esquinca.This compilation came out in 2023, yet the title account was initially posted in 2006, in BOMB publication. In it, a forensic entomologist's other half is actually slaughtered. It's established that she should possess been actually killed when, most likely, she was actually asleep in mattress with the lead character. This is actually despite the fact that her physical body was actually discovered in a rainforest miles away. Linked along with the unraveling story are actually simple facts the lead character allotments regarding pests that infest remains, and also just how they may be used to figure out a time of fatality and also also to record a killer. InSEXts by Marguerite Bennett, Ariela Kristantina, Bryan Valenza, and also A Bigger world.In this comic series, 2 females in the Victorian age-- that likewise happen to be secret fanatics-- find the potential to transform right into frightening human-insect combinations. They utilize this electrical power to specific counterattack versus the one woman's heartless partner (in the absolute most rewarding means achievable), which enables them to lastly be together. Come for the femme fatales. Stay for the body terror.
She Is actually a Haunting through Trang Thanh Tran.First of all, enjoy this cover. This YA story created it onto my TBR on the stamina of that alone. The premise is actually quite darn great, too. A girl gos to her withheld father brown in Vietnam, identified to quadrate him for 5 full weeks to make sure that she can easily obtain the university money he's assured her. But things obtain unusual fast, as her father looks staying in a leechlike ghost home that participates in range to a lot of bugs that as if to sneak where they don't belong. The book takes on concepts of identity, colonialism, and also intergenerational damage.

The Swarm by Andy Marino.This is yet another honest title (Nov 2024), and I can not hang around to read it. In it, numerous cicadas seem suddenly, totally off their usual every-17-years rhythm. When they switch threatening, the cast of characters within this manual problem to determine what lags the harmful flock. However Certainly not Too Vibrant by Hache Pueyo.And also here is actually the final bug-laden label I am actually awaiting (however, to be fair, arachnids are actually neither bugs neither bugs instead, they remain in a course all their own.:: shivers::-RRB-. In this particular dark gothic dream, a huge humanoid crawler with a taste for human brides needs to have a brand-new keeper-- since she consumed the last one. Du00e1lia is actually the lucky gal, as well as we observe her as she becomes her new part, hailing her as she looks at the fatality of her predecessor as well as makes an effort to steer clear of being actually consumed herself.
